I have a couple of observations and queries which in no particular order are:
  • The example skin shows
    Code:
    Plugin=Plugins\HWiNFO.dll
    , you can simply use
    Code:
    Plugin=HWiNFO
    , saves a few keystrokes :cool:
  • At PC startup HWInfo needs me to click OK on a UAC box. I can live with that but it doesn't always pop up and then I have to manually launch HWInfo (Win8 64-bit :mad: )
  • Sensors are checked but don't seem to start, which means double clicking the tray icon clicking the sensors button, minimising all 3 screens that pop up and refreshing skins that show Device names due to
    Code:
    UpdateDivider=...

Yes, there's currently a limitation when you want HWiNFO to start automatically with UAC enabled. The best solution for this is to configure HWiNFO using Windows Task Scheduler.

On the plugin name....probably just a carry over from my first RM skin back in v1.3 or something like that. If the short name works fine, great.

One the device names, its a race condition that I mention in this thread. HWiNFO needs to start first, or a RM refresh (manual or timed) is required.
